Job strain is a form of psychosocial stress that occurs in the workplace. One of the most common forms of stress, it is characterized by a combination of low salaries, high demands, and low levels of control over things such as raises and paid time off. Anxiety, insomnia, high blood pressure, a weakened immune system, and heart … Ver mais • Karoshi • Labor rights • Occupational burnout • Occupational stress Ver mais Web10 de dez. de 2010 · Job strain occurs when job demands are high and job decision latitude is low” (52, p. 287). Decision latitude is an operationalization of the concept of control and has often been defined as the combination of job decision-making authority and the opportunity to use and develop skills on the job. Web10 de set. de 2011 · Karasek’s “job strain” model states that the greatest risk to physical and mental health from stress occurs to workers facing high psychological workload demands or pressures combined with low control or decision latitude in meeting those demands. Web27 de jun. de 2024 · Robert Karasek has put his Job Demand Control model in a diagram. The horizontal x-axis shows the job demands, which can by high or low. The vertical y-axis shows the job decision latitude, which can also be high or low.
